Similarly, you may ask, what smell do wasps hate?
It's easy-- wasps and hornets HATE the scent of peppermint oil. Mix a tablespoon of peppermint oil with four cups of water, and you've got a powerful repellent spray; it's even effective enough to drive the wasps and hornets from their nests, but without dangerous chemicals.

Also, what home remedy will kill wasps?
Try diluting a little peppermint oil in water and spraying it where you frequently get wasps. You can also plant peppermint in your garden to deter the little critters. Another option is to mix a cup of white vinegar with a cup of water and put it in a spray bottle.
How do you deter wasps?
Use Herbs. Wasps don't like herbs that are very aromatic, especially spearmint, thyme, citronella, and eucalyptus. Plant some of these around your patio and outdoor sitting areas to repel wasps.

Wasps will not chase you unless you disturb them. In the process of stinging they mark you with a chemical odor that makes it easy for other wasps to find you. If you run, they will chase you and they are faster than you. Yellow jackets and paper wasps will not chase you very far, unless you have destroyed their nest.How do you keep wasps from coming back?

Do citronella candles repel wasps?
Citronella-based products, which vary in efficacy, repel other various insects, including wasps, bees and ticks.
